Transaction 21a35f23ef8bb1f20bd309738445653b35794f195464d641b823416e0d220ee6
1 Input
1 Output
-
21a35f23ef8bb1f20bd309738445653b35794f195464d641b823416e0d220ee6:0
- value
- 4221421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67d2832c69040c9ec0c3b217c42a24040fc3c1e6 OP_EQUAL
- address
- 3B9yhxdjMfuvKVSL7Rg39AF3idVBTU5ATM